Learn more about Bing search results hereOrganizing and summarizing search results for youAttraction and repulsion of magnets are fundamental properties based on their poles:- Attraction occurs when opposite poles (North and South) of two magnets are brought together.
- Repulsion happens when like poles (North-North or South-South) are brought together.
- The interaction between magnets is due to their magnetic fields, which exert forces on each other.
- The strength of these forces is influenced by the distance between the magnets and their pole strength.
These principles explain how magnets interact in various applications.

Attraction and repulsion of magnets — lesson.
The opposite poles of magnets attract, whereas the similar poles of magnets repel when they are pulled towards each other. Attraction or repulsion of the magnets depends on the direction of the poles facing each other.
